The Side Effects of Saw Palmetto

No Tags

To understand the side effects of Saw Palmetto you must first understand what it is. Saw Palmetto extract comes from the white flowers that grow on the palm plant and produces berries, and is comprised of fatty acids including lauric acid, oleic acid, myristic acid, along with palmitic acid. Saw Palmetto also contains plant sterols and polysaccharides, which are known to help balance hormones. 

 

Now that an understanding of where the plant comes from lets proceed to explain the side effects of saw palmetto along with the long-term effects. 

 

Although saw palmetto is used in a variety of ways and is effective for treating many BPH symptoms there are no known long-term side affects noted at this time due to the lack of documented information. What this means is that because of the undocumented information we really do not know if there are long-term side effects connected to using saw palmetto.

 

What we do know is that there are a few noted minor side effects directly related to the use of saw palmetto. Some of the information that has been provided by the medical field and scientific studies state that some people who participated had one or several of the following minor side effects that were directly related to using saw palmetto.

 

These side effects included: loss of sexual desire, sore or tender breasts and mild stomach discomfort, dizziness, insomnia, fatigue, rash, diarrhea and mild headaches. Many of these side effects may or may not occur as with any herbal extract you take. It is always suggested that you consult with a medical professional before taking any herbal supplement as it ensures safe and coordinated care.
